On Fri, Jul 04, 2025 at 12:33:32PM +0530, Anup Patel wrote:
> The SBI v3.0 (MPXY extension) [1] and RPMI v1.0 [2] specifications
> are frozen and finished public review at the RISC-V International.
> 
> Currently, most of the RPMI and MPXY drivers are in OpenSBI whereas
> Linux only has SBI MPXY mailbox controller driver, RPMI clock driver
> and RPMI system MSI driver This series also includes ACPI support
> for SBI MPXY mailbox controller and RPMI system MSI drivers.
> 
> These patches can be found in the riscv_sbi_mpxy_mailbox_v8 branch
> at: https://github.com/avpatel/linux.git
> 
> To test these patches, boot Linux on "virt,rpmi=on,aia=aplic-imsic"
> machine with OpenSBI and QEMU from the dev-upstream branch at:
> https://github.com/ventanamicro/opensbi.git
> https://github.com/ventanamicro/qemu.git
